| What to Check | Red Flags | Green Light |
|---|---|---|
| License Authority | Not listed, generic « Gaming License » | UKGC, Malta, Curacao (verify on official site) |
| Wagering Requirement | Over 40x, no cap on max win | Under 40x, max win capped at £500 or less |
| Game Contribution | Slots contribute 10%, all others 0% | At least 50% for slots, 20% for table games |
| Expiry Time | « No expiry » – lies | 7 days or less, clearly stated |

Questions and Answers:
How do I use the phone casino promo code to get my bonus?
Once you find a valid phone casino promo code, go to the casino’s website or app and sign up for a new account. During registration, look for a field labeled « Promo Code, » « Bonus Code, » or « Referral Code. » Enter the code exactly as it appears—case-sensitive in some cases. After submitting the code and completing your registration, the bonus should be applied automatically. If it doesn’t appear right away, check your account dashboard or contact customer support. Make sure to read the terms, such as wagering requirements or game restrictions, before using the bonus.
Are phone casino promo codes only for new players?
Most phone casino promo codes are designed for new players to encourage sign-ups. These often come with welcome bonuses like free spins or match deposits. However, some casinos also offer codes for existing players, especially during special events or holidays. These might be shared via email newsletters, app notifications, or loyalty program updates. Always check the code’s description or the casino’s promotions page to see if it’s available to current users. Some codes are exclusive to returning players and may offer different rewards than those for new ones.
Can I use more than one promo code at a time on a phone casino site?
Generally, phone casinos allow only one promo code per account at a time. Using multiple codes simultaneously is not supported by most platforms. If you try to enter more than one, the system will usually accept only the last one entered or reject the attempt altogether. Some promotions may have specific rules about stacking bonuses, but this is rare. It’s best to check the terms of each code before applying it. If you’re unsure, contact the casino’s support team for clarification.
What should I do if my phone casino promo code isn’t working?
If a promo code doesn’t work, first make sure it’s entered correctly—double-check for typos, extra spaces, or incorrect capitalization. Some codes are only valid during certain times or for specific games. Verify that the code is still active by checking the casino’s promotions page or recent emails. Also, ensure you’re using the correct device and account type (e.g., mobile app vs. web version). If the issue persists, contact the casino’s support team with details like the code, your account info, and the error message. They can confirm whether the code is expired, restricted, or not compatible with your region.
Do phone casino promo codes have time limits?
Yes, most phone casino promo codes come with expiration dates. The time limit is usually stated when the code is shared—either in the email, app notification, or on the casino’s promotions page. Some codes are valid for just a few days, while others may last several weeks. If a code is time-sensitive, it’s best to use it as soon as possible after receiving it. Even if the code is still technically active, the bonus offer might end before you claim it. Always check the full terms before applying the code to avoid missing out.
